All Supported consoles that are connected on your network will be able to connect to kai and play.

but will all be in the same arena, and you should only have on UI connected to control what arena you are in.

So you "could" use your xbox and PS2 at the same time, but as you can only be in one arena you couldnt be in Xbox/F P S/Counter Strike and PS2/Driving/ GT 4 at the same time.

So to answer your question.

Yes as many as you want... but I would only use one xbox for navigating Kai in XBMC.  you could in fact use one xbox for the XBMC kai use and play on the other so that you can move from arena to arena.

QUOTE(RichMR2 @ Oct 13 2005, 10:28 AM)
Can the 2 xboxes with xbmc both connect to kia using the same PC, same u/n & p/w?
No.

QUOTE(RichMR2 @ Oct 13 2005, 10:28 AM)
Say if me and my bro wanted to play counterstrike on kia, could we both do this with the same PC/Username/Password etc?
Use 1 interface as Taz said.

XLink Thumb rule:

1 XLink Kai engine per subnet.
1 Kai user interface per XLink Kai egine.
Multiple Xboxes per XLink Kai engine.

On other words:

1 engine on the pc or router, 1 interface on the pc or in XBMC, as many Xboxes as you'd like.
